Food & grocery retail sales accounted for the highest share, at 63.8% of the total Slovakian retail market in 2016. The sector registered sales of €13.1 billion in 2016 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 3.7% during 2016-2021 to reach €15.7 billion by 2021. Sales are expected to grow on the back of various store expansion strategies being adopted by the major food & grocery retailers in the country. The food & grocery sector in Slovakia is dominated by mass market players. Coop remains the leading player with a share of 11% of the sector, followed by Tesco and Lidl with shares of 10.9% and 7.2% respectively. Conversely, online grocery shopping is still in a nascent stage and commanded only 0.4% of sector sales in 2016.
